Rewarming after cooling therapy increases the odds of seizures in oxygen-deprived newborns – News-Medical.Net

Oxygen-deprived newborns who undergo cooling therapy to protect their brains are at an elevated risk of seizures and brain damage during the rewarming period, which could be a precursor of disability or death, a new study by a team of researchers led by…
